InsCipher is a B2B software and services company that simplifies surplus lines tax calculation, filing, and payment for insurance industry participants. It offers a SOC-2 certified SaaS platform (InsCipher ConnectÂŽ), fully-managed filing services, and developer APIs (Tax Calculator API, Tax Docs API) to help MGAs, brokers, retail agencies, and carriers automate tax compliance and reporting across U. S. states and territories.

📋 Description

• Define the AI engineering roadmap and architecture standards across the organization • Lead build vs. buy vs. integrate decisions for AI systems and platforms • Evaluate emerging tools, frameworks, and models and provide recommendations to leadership • Serve as the ultimate technical escalation point for complex AI/ML system design challenges • Architect AI solutions for the enterprise platform across process and underlying platform architecture layers • Design systems for scale, reliability, and cost-efficiency in production environments • Establish LLMOps practices, including evaluation and regression suites, cost and quality observability, versioned prompts and configurations, staged rollout and rollback, and production guardrails • Ensure AI systems integrate cleanly with existing product and engineering infrastructure • Partner with Product and Engineering leadership to align AI capabilities with business outcomes • Coordinate cross-functional engagement while focusing on technical leadership and decision-making • Guide resource allocation and engagement sequencing • Translate complex technical concepts for executives and business stakeholders • Challenge approaches that compromise long-term system health • Champion and introduce AI-assisted coding practices and developer tooling across engineering • Define standards for responsible AI development, guardrails, evaluation frameworks, and security considerations • Drive continuous improvement in building and shipping AI-powered features • Perform other duties as requested, directed, or assigned

🎯 Requirements

•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related quantitative field, or equivalent practical experience • 5+ years of software engineering experience with a meaningful portion in production AI/ML or LLM/GenAI systems • 2+ years building production LLM/GenAI and agentic systems • Fluency with AI-assisted coding tooling and judgment to set organization-wide standards, evaluations, and guardrails for AI-generated code • Demonstrated track record of rebuilding an existing business process with AI at its core within an existing enterprise environment, shipped to production and owned the outcome • Production experience with LLM/GenAI and agentic systems, including agent orchestration, tool calling, RAG, and structured outputs • Sound judgment about appropriate and inappropriate AI use in customer-facing, research, policy binding, money movement, and compliance flows • Experience making and communicating organizational build vs. buy vs. integrate decisions • Proficiency in Python and the modern GenAI application stack, including agent and orchestration frameworks, model-provider SDKs, vector databases, and evaluation tooling •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ills • Preferred: Direct evidence of legacy-process redesign with latitude to alter underlying platform architecture • Preferred: Enterprise or regulated-domain experience, ideally in insurance or financial services • Preferred: Technical lead or principal engineer experience with broad organizational influence • Preferred: Experience working closely with product engineering teams in a dual-track agile model • Preferred: Experience with AI cost management, observability, and governance frameworks
